Looks like a model 33 snapper picker. I started farming in 1982 with an outfit exactly like that. I bought it out of a fencerow for $200. Took the picker off and threw it away. Sideshields and front screen, too. Wish I had them back. Rented 107 ac repo ground from FMHA. Bought a Allis 4 row500 unit planter for $50. Bought a 2 bottom plow for $100 in the southern part of the state. Went to work. Harvested with a $1200 JD 45 square back. Seems like a long time ago. Survived the 80s and 90s. Restored the tractor in 91. Still have it. Needs overhauled and painted again. Thanks for the memory jog!
